Job Summary
CNA assists RN with daily patient care in Cardiac Neuro unit (Part-time 24 hours/week, 0.6 FTE, every other weekend and holiday). Responsibilities include bathing, oral hygiene, feeding, activity orders, ambulation with assistive devices, vital sign collection (BP, TPR), I&O, daily weights, EMR documentation, purposeful RN-guided rounding, patient transfers, specimen collection, supply management, and maintaining equipment and room readiness. Requires adherence to infection prevention, proper attire, and the ability to lift and position patients; must meet age-specific care needs and participate in admission/transfer/discharge tasks under RN supervision. Licensure/Certification: BLS and Nurse Aide registration in good standing; Education: GED/HSED or high school diploma. Benefits and compensation reflect hospital policies and the posted pay range.”,
Required Qualifications
- Basic Life Support (BLS) for Healthcare Providers certification issued by the American Heart Association (AHA) needs to be obtained within 45 days
- Nurse Aide in good standing as indicated with the State Registry in which the team member practices
- Education Required: GED or High School Equivalency Diploma (HSED), or High School Graduate
